Summary: |
A young black man struggles to find his place in the world while growing up in a rough neighborhood of Miami. |

Item Description: |
Title from container. Based on the play "In moonlight black boys look blue" by Tarell Alvin McCraney. Originally released as a motion picture in 2016. Widescreen. Special features: Audio commentary with director Barry Jenkins; Ensemble of emotion: the making of Moonlight; Poetry through collaboration: the music of Moonlight; Cruel beauty: filming in Miami. |
